Edouard de Lamaze, an Attorney at the Paris Bar, was successively a delegate to the Caisse Nationale des Barreaux français (CNBF), elected by the Paris Bar to be a member of the Union Nationale des Professions Libérales , President of the Union des jeunes avocats de Paris, and President of the Fédération nationale des unions de jeunes avocats (FNUJA).

 

In 1995, he was elected Member of the Conseil de l'Ordre de Paris. He then became the inter-ministerial delegate for independent professionals and the general secretary of the Comité interministériel aux professions libérales. Since 2004, he has been the President of the Observatoire nationale des professions libérales (ONPL).

 

In 2006, he was nominated to the Commission des comptes des services auprès du Ministère de l'Economie et des Finances. In 2010, he became a member of the European Economic and Social Committee. He has also published a number of works, including Cinq années au service des professions libérales (LGDJ).
